Salary & Benefits Salary: £30,000 per annum Additional Pay: Uncapped commission scheme Expected OTE of £35,000+ About BitePRO® BitePRO®, part of the PPSS Group, designs, manufactures and supplies specialist personal protective clothing developed to protect healthcare professionals from human bites and related workplace violence. Trusted by healthcare providers, mental health services, secure units and specialist care organisations across the UK and internationally, BitePRO is committed to delivering innovative protective solutions and exceptional customer service.
